Ниже представлена схема простого термометра на PIC’е. Индикатор (в моём случае BA56-12SRWA) используется с общим анодом.
Датчик температуры DS18B20 (разрешение 0.1’C) или DS1820 (разрешение 0.5’C). Программа сама определит тип датчика.
При отсутсвии датчика на линии мигает «Err» .
При выходе измеряемого значения за пределы измерения мигает «—» .
Диапазон измерения от -55’C до 125’C.
В архиве находится файл для Proteus’а и программа в HEX. Потому Вы сами сможете промоделировать схему и посмотреть как она работает.
Скачать прошивку HEX и файл для Proteus’а можно ниже
Список радиоэлементовОбозначение
Тип
Номинал
Количество
ПримечаниеМагазинМой блокнот
DD1
МК PIC 8-битPIC16F628A1
Датчик температурыDS18B201
DS1820
Резистор4.7 кОм1
Кварцевый резонатор20 МГц1
Светодиодный индикаторBA56-12SRWA1
Добавить все
Скачать список элементов (PDF)
Прикрепленные файлы:
- ds.rar (58 Кб)